Apidog

All-in-one Collaborative API Development Platform

Design de API

Documentação de API

Depuração de API

Mock de API

Testes Automatizados de API

Inscreva-se gratuitamente
Home / Tudo que Você Precisa Saber Sobre o Cursor AI: Seu Co-Piloto de Codificação Alimentado por IA

Tudo que Você Precisa Saber Sobre o Cursor AI: Seu Co-Piloto de Codificação Alimentado por IA

Já se encontrou parado diante do seu editor de código, sentindo que está preso em um purgatório de codificação? Você não está sozinho. Codificar pode ser incrível, mas também vem com sua cota de frustrações. Seja bloqueio criativo para aquela próxima linha de código ou ciclos intermináveis de depuração, às vezes você só precisa de uma mão amiga.

É aí que o Cursor AI entra em cena, pronto para se tornar seu co-piloto de codificação definitivo. Mas antes de você mergulhar de cabeça no mundo da codificação com inteligência artificial, vamos examinar tudo que você precisa saber sobre o Cursor AI.

O que é o Cursor AI?

Imagine um editor de código que não só entende seu código, mas também antecipa seu próximo movimento. Essa é a mágica do Cursor AI. Esta ferramenta inovadora usa inteligência artificial para analisar sua base de código, sugerir melhorias e até gerar novos trechos de código instantaneamente.

Pense nisso como ter um desenvolvedor experiente sussurrando sabedoria de codificação em seu ouvido (sem a dor de ouvido, é claro). O Cursor AI é projetado para aumentar sua produtividade, simplificar seu fluxo de trabalho e, no final das contas, tornar a codificação mais agradável.

Como o Cursor AI Funciona?

O cérebro por trás do Cursor AI reside em seu poderoso modelo de IA. Este modelo é treinado em vastos conjuntos de dados de código, permitindo que ele entenda a sintaxe de codificação, padrões e melhores práticas. Quando você está codificando, o Cursor AI analisa sua base de código em tempo real, levando em conta coisas como:

  • A linguagem de programação específica que você está usando (o Cursor AI suporta várias linguagens, mas falaremos mais sobre isso depois).
  • A estrutura e lógica do seu código.
  • Padrões comuns de codificação e melhores práticas.

Com base nessa análise, o Cursor AI oferece uma gama de recursos que podem potencializar sua experiência de codificação.

Por que os Desenvolvedores Amam o Cursor AI

Então, o que faz o Cursor AI se destacar? Aqui estão alguns dos principais recursos que conquistaram os corações dos desenvolvedores:

1. Sugestões de Código com AI

Uma das características mais notáveis do Cursor AI é sua capacidade de sugerir código em tempo real. À medida que você digita, a IA analisa sua entrada e sugere possíveis conclusões, trechos de código ou até correções de erros. Este recurso economiza tempo, especialmente quando você está trabalhando com código repetitivo ou linguagens de programação pesadas em sintaxe.

2. Detecção de Erros e Depuração

O Cursor AI não apenas ajuda você a escrever código, mas também melhora a qualidade do seu código. Seu sofisticado sistema de detecção de erros identifica problemas potenciais em tempo real, oferecendo soluções ou explicações para auxiliar na depuração. Diga adeus àquelas falhas irritantes que aparecem quando você está concentrado. Acesse os melhores insights da sua base de código ou consulte arquivos específicos e documentação sem esforço. Utilize o código do modelo com apenas um clique.

3. Assistência Baseada em Contexto

As capacidades baseadas em contexto do Cursor AI garantem que as sugestões que você recebe sejam relevantes para a tarefa em questão. Se você está trabalhando com APIs, por exemplo, ele irá oferecer sugestões relacionadas a endpoints de API, métodos de autenticação ou bibliotecas específicas como Apidog.

4. Suporte a Múltiplas Linguagens

Se você está codificando em Python, JavaScript ou qualquer outra linguagem de programação popular, o Cursor AI tem tudo coberto. Ele suporta uma ampla gama de linguagens de programação, tornando-se uma ferramenta versátil para desenvolvedores que trabalham em ambientes diversos.

5. Fluxos de Trabalho Personalizáveis

O Cursor AI permite que você adapte seu ambiente de codificação às suas preferências. Seja integrando bibliotecas específicas, como Apidog para gerenciamento de APIs, ou modificando a interface para se adequar ao seu estilo, o Cursor AI oferece opções de personalização flexíveis.

Como o Cursor AI se Compara aos Editores de Código Tradicionais?

O Cursor AI não é apenas mais um editor de código; é um assistente com IA que eleva toda a experiência de codificação. Mas como ele se compara a editores tradicionais como Visual Studio Code (VSCode) ou Sublime Text?

1. Autocompletar Inteligente vs. Digitação Manual

Nos editores tradicionais, a autocompletar geralmente se baseia em trechos predefinidos ou simples reconhecimento de padrões. O Cursor AI leva isso um passo além ao usar aprendizado de máquina para prever o que você provavelmente digitará a seguir, tornando o processo muito mais intuitivo e personalizado.

2. Depuração Proativa vs. Depuração Reativa

Embora editores tradicionais ofereçam ferramentas de depuração, você muitas vezes precisa executar o código para identificar erros. O Cursor AI, por outro lado, sinaliza problemas potenciais em tempo real enquanto você escreve. Essa abordagem proativa minimiza o tempo de depuração e reduz o número de erros que vão parar no seu código final.

3. Assistência com AI vs. Autossuficiência

O Cursor AI atua como um mentor, oferecendo sugestões, soluções e insights sobre seu código. Em contraste, editores tradicionais deixam grande parte da responsabilidade com o desenvolvedor para pesquisar documentação, procurar respostas online ou confiar em conhecimentos pessoais.

Para quem o Cursor AI é Perfeito?

O Cursor AI é uma ferramenta valiosa para uma ampla gama de desenvolvedores, desde veteranos experientes até novatos entusiasmados. Aqui está como ele atende a diferentes níveis de codificação:

  • Desenvolvedores Experientes: Mesmo os melhores desenvolvedores podem se beneficiar de uma ajuda extra. O Cursor AI pode aumentar sua produtividade ao automatizar tarefas tediosas e sugerir melhorias de código que você pode ter esquecido.
  • Desenvolvedores Juniores: Aprender a codificar pode ser esmagador. O Cursor AI pode fornecer um ambiente de apoio ao oferecer dicas, sugestões e explicações. É como ter um desenvolvedor mais experiente mentorando você em cada passo do caminho.
  • Estudantes: Se você está aprendendo a codificar em sala de aula ou é autodidata, o Cursor AI pode ser um companheiro de estudo valioso. Ele pode ajudar você a entender melhor conceitos de codificação e captar possíveis erros em seu código.

Dicas para Aproveitar ao Máximo o Cursor AI

Para maximizar os benefícios do Cursor AI, mantenha essas dicas em mente:

  • Abrace as Sugestões: Não tenha medo de experimentar as sugestões do Cursor AI. Pode te surpreender o quão frequentemente elas levam a um código mais limpo e eficiente.
  • Forneça um Contexto Claro: Quanto mais informações você der ao Cursor AI sobre seu projeto, melhor ele pode moldar suas sugestões. Seja descritivo em seus comentários de código e use nomes de variáveis significativos.
  • Personalize Configurações: O Cursor AI oferece várias configurações para ajustar seu comportamento. Experimente diferentes opções para encontrar a configuração perfeita para seu fluxo de trabalho.

O Futuro da Codificação com AI

O Cursor AI é apenas o começo da revolução da IA na codificação. À medida que a tecnologia de IA continua a avançar, podemos esperar que ferramentas ainda mais sofisticadas apareçam. Imagine editores de código que podem não apenas sugerir melhorias, mas também gerar módulos de código inteiros com base em suas exigências. As possibilidades são infinitas.

Conclusão

No mundo da codificação, ter as ferramentas certas pode fazer toda a diferença. O Cursor AI é uma dessas ferramentas que têm o potencial de transformar sua experiência de codificação. Ao automatizar tarefas repetitivas, sugerir melhorias e fornecer geração de código inteligente, o Cursor AI pode ajudar você a se tornar um desenvolvedor mais eficiente e produtivo.

Então, o que você está esperando? Experimente o Cursor AI e veja como ele pode elevar sua jornada de codificação. E não esqueça de explorar o poder do Apidog para ainda mais simplificar suas interações com APIs. Juntas, essas ferramentas podem ajudar você a desbloquear todo o seu potencial de codificação.

Junte-se à Newsletter da Apidog

Inscreva-se para ficar atualizado e receber os últimos pontos de vista a qualquer momento.